"If I were rich one day ..." is how the daydreams of the milkman Tevje from the small Ukrainian "shtetl" Anatevka begin at the beginning of the 20th century. Tevje is a pious, humorous man, but beaten with "a stable full of daughters" to marry off. His three eldest in particular do not want what their father wants, for whom tradition is the only standard: "Because of these traditions, everyone here in Anatevka knows what to do and what not to do and what the good Lord expects of them."
After some initial indignation, Tevje takes it in his stride when he is forced to correct his philosophy of life time and time again. But then the milkman's world comes apart at the seams: the entire Jewish population is expelled from Anatevka in a pogrom.
Since its premiere on Broadway in New York in 1964, ANATEVKA has been one of the classics of the musical repertoire, even in Germany. It is one of the most haunting works in the history of musicals. A tightrope walk between comedy and tragedy, between Jewish wit and heartfelt sadness.
